Sure, I'd be happy to explain the word "catafalque" to you! So, a catafalque is like a structure that's used for holding a casket or a coffin during a funeral or a memorial ceremony. It's kind of like a platform or a stand that serves as a temporary resting place for the person who has passed away. The idea is to create a dignified and solemn setting for honoring and remembering the person who has died.

Sometimes, a catafalque can be quite elaborate and ornate, with decorations and symbols that are meaningful to the person being honored. It's basically a way to show respect and reverence for the deceased, and to provide a focal point for those who are mourning to gather around and pay their respects.

In some cultures and traditions, catafalques are also used in religious or ceremonial settings, not just for funerals. For example, you might see a catafalque being used during a special memorial service or a religious observance. It's a way of symbolizing the spiritual significance of the person being honored, and serving as a reminder of their legacy.

So, to sum it up, a catafalque is a structure that's used to hold a casket or coffin during a funeral or memorial ceremony, and it's a way of showing respect and creating a dignified setting for honoring and remembering the person who has passed away. I hope that makes sense to you!
